The Best Games That Support HOTAS

Controllers and keyboards aren’t the only ways to game. HOTAS, which stands for Hands on Throttle-And-Stick, is one of the most immersive ways to play. There are a variety of kinds and you can use them to gain total control of your aerial vehicles in a large number of titles. Related:The Best Combat Flight Simulators This emulates how pilots have controlled aircraft since the late 1950s. It can take some time to get used to, but its realism and command are hard to pass up....
